One of Klaus' old vampire friends arrives in New Orleans, but he's got some sort of secret agenda. Hayley struggles with being cursed to her wolf form in the bayou. Marcel, who's back in control of the French quarter, is recruiting vampires.

And there are a series of gruesome murders that may be the work of a serial killer.
